For a TM 5.1, would you guys suggest a PDI 6.01 or a Tanio koba twist barrel (6.04?) ?? Which one would have improved accuracy and overall better performance?
|
Quote:
|
Quote:
Nine Ball 6.03mm or PDI 6.05mm inner barrels shoot with lower velocity, but are more consistent and more accurate than a 6.01mm or tighter barrel. But again, you still have to lob the projectile at distances. Twist barrels shoot laser straight. If you're used to shooting regular airsoft guns and having to lob the shot, shooting a projectile through a Twist barrel and having it fly in such a flat line may be unnerving. However, at distances, as the BB slows down, it may veer off course inconsistently. I'm talking about at the extreme ends of its flight path. So at close to medium to almost far ranges, Twist barrels offer point of aim, point of impact, and very consistent shots. If it means anything, I use Twist barrels in any of my <5.1" barreled pistols. |

TM Detonics question....whats usable from the full-size 1911/Hi-Capa that can be carried to Detonics? Hammer? Trigger? Safeties? What about the internal?
|
Quote:
I know the sear and knocker is the same as a 1911. The hammer strut is different. The hammer... I'm unsure about. I've never seen a hammer that's marketed to fit both, and I've seen hammers that are marked for "Detonics" with no mention of compatibility with other platforms. Triggers are the same. I would imagine the trigger stirrup is also the same. The leaf spring I'd need to look at, I suspect that it's shorter. Safety levers are the same (1911), as are slide catch, mag catch, hammer pin and sear pin. Piston head is different. Standard Marui pistol hop up mount. |
